- SummaryMaintaining poor legacy code, interpreting cryptic comments, and writing the same boilerplate over and over can suck the joy out of your life as a Java developer. Fear not! There's hope! Kotlin is an elegant JVM language with modern features and easy integration with Java. The Joy of Kotlin teaches you practical techniques to improve abstraction and design, to write comprehensible code, and to build maintainable bug-free applications.Purchase of the print book includes a free eBook in PDF, Kindle, and ePub formats from Manning Publications.About the TechnologyYour programming language should be expressive, safe, flexible, and intuitive, and Kotlin checks all the boxes! This elegant JVM language integrates seamlessly with Java, and makes it a breeze to switch between OO and functional styles of programming. It's also fully supported by Google as a first-class Android language. Master the powerful techniques in this unique book, and you'll be able to take on new challenges with increased confidence and skill.About the BookThe Joy of Kotlin teaches you to write comprehensible, easy-to-maintain, safe programs with Kotlin. In this expert guide, seasoned engineer Pierre-Yves Saumont teaches you to approach common programming challenges with a fresh, FP-inspired perspective. As you work through the many examples, you'll dive deep into handling errors and data properly, managing state, and taking advantage of laziness. The author's down-to-earth examples and experience-driven insights will make you a better—and more joyful—developer!What's insideProgramming with functionsDealing with optional dataSafe handling of errors and exceptionsHandling and sharing state mutationAbout the ReaderWritten for intermediate Java or Kotlin developers.About the AuthorPierre-Yves Saumont is a senior software engineer at Alcatel-Submarine Networks. He's the author of Functional Programming in Java (Manning, 2017).Table of ContentsMaking programs saferFunctional programming in Kotlin: An overviewProgramming with functionsRecursion, corecursion, and memoizationData handling with listsDealing with optional dataHandling errors and exceptionsAdvanced list handlingWorking with lazinessMore data handling with treesSolving problems with advanced treesFunctional input/outputSharing mutable states with actorsSolving common problems functionally
